#### Exploring the **Best Place to Dive in Vietnam**: A Regional Breakdown

Vietnam's long coastline offers that the best time to dive can vary significantly between one region and the next. Here's a look at of the primary diving hubs:

**1. Nha Trang: The Classic Hub of **Vietnam Diving****

If you've heard of diving in Vietnam, you've probably heard of Nha Trang. It's home to the Hon Mun Marine Park, a protected area established to preserve the local reefs.
* **The Vibe:** Lively, bustling, and very accessible. It's a hub for backpackers and those new to diving.
* **What You'll See:** {Primarily known for its impressive hard coral gardens and a decent variety of macro life.|The corals in the marine park are very healthy, and you can find a lot of clownfish, pipefish, and small critters.
* **Downsides:** Due to its popularity, it can get extremely crowded, particularly in the high season. It's not known for large pelagic fish.

**2. Con Dao Islands: The Pristine Frontier**

For the serious diver, the Con Dao archipelago is frequently hailed as the **best place to dive in vietnam**. {As a protected National Park, the underwater environment is exceptionally healthy and its biodiversity is fantastic in the country.
* **Atmosphere:** {Quiet, remote, and all about nature and conservation. It's more difficult and expensive to get to, but that keeps the crowds away.
* **What You'll See:** {This is one of the best places in Vietnam to reliably see sea turtles (both Green and Hawksbill), since they nest on the remote beaches here. You'll also find large schools of reef fish, bigger fish such as giant trevally, and even the Dugong.
* **Downsides:S** Diving is highly seasonal. {Outside of this window, the seas are often very choppy. It's also the most expensive dive destination in Vietnam.

**3. Hoi An / Cham Islands (Cu Lao Cham): The Cultural Combo**

A short boat ride off the coast of the beautiful, ancient city of Hoi An lies the Cham Islands, a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ve. {This offers a wonderful chance to mix your historical exploration with an underwater adventure.
* **Atmosphere:** It's a great "add-on" to a cultural trip. Most operations are day trips.
* **What You'll See:** {The reserve boasts healthy coral and a solid population of reef fish.|You'll find many common reef fish. The underwater terrain is a highlight.
* **Considerations:** The dive season is very limited (typically June to August). {Visibility is often very changeable and is often less clear as in other regions.

**4. Phu Quoc Island & The An Thoi Archipelago: The Rising Star Paradise**

Last but not least is Phu Quoc, in the far south. {This destination has been quickly gaining a reputation as a fantastic diving destination, especially in the Northern Hemisphere's winter months (October to April), when much of the rest of country's coastline is un-divable due to monsoons.|The calm, protected waters of the An Thoi Archipelago to the south make it an ideal location for both beginners and certified divers seeking relaxed, beautiful dives.
* **Atmosphere:** {Relaxed, tropical, and exceptionally welcoming. {The seas are usually like glass, and the {water is always tepid. This is not a destination for deep, technical dives and more about enjoying beautiful, shallow reefs.
* **Marine Life:** {Phu Quoc is famous for its stunning critters. {Divers regularly spot rare creatures. {The coral formations are also remarkably healthy and extensive, and the famous anemone reefs are swarming with countless clownfish.
